How can companies effectively measure the impact of internal customer experience stories shared through video, podcast, and newsletter formats on employee engagement and their prioritization of customer satisfaction?
Companies can measure the impact of internal customer experience stories shared through video, podcast, and newsletter formats by tracking metrics such as views, shares, and engagement rates. They can also conduct surveys or interviews with employees to gather feedback on how these stories have influenced their engagement and prioritization of customer satisfaction. Additionally, companies can monitor changes in key performance indicators related to customer satisfaction and employee satisfaction to assess the impact of these stories on overall business outcomes. Regularly collecting and analyzing data on these metrics will help companies understand the effectiveness of their internal communication efforts in driving employee engagement and customer satisfaction.
